Selecionando uma interface NPP
Os provedores de pacotes de rede (NPPs) expõem as interfaces IDelaydC, IESP, IRTCe IStats. Cada uma dessas interfaces fornece métodos semelhantes para conectar o NPP à rede, capturar o tráfego da rede e coletar informações estatísticas sobre os dados capturados. Para escolher qual interface usar, consulte a tabela a seguir.
Observação
Quando você conecta um NPP à rede com uma dessas interfaces, você só pode usar os métodos fornecidos por essa interface. Por exemplo, se você se conectar à rede usando a interface IRTC e, em seguida, tentar iniciar uma captura com IDelaydC, sua chamada para iniciar a captura falhará e um código de erro será retornado.
Interface | Quando utilizar |
---|---|
IDelaydC | Use para capturar o tráfego de rede e armazená-lo em um arquivo de captura. Essa interface é usada pela interface do usuário do Monitor de Rede e outros aplicativos NPP, que exigem o armazenamento de informações de rede capturadas. |
IESP | Usado para fornecer estatísticas aprimoradas em um formato de arquivo ESP especial. Esta interface é usada por aplicativos NPP que exigem as estatísticas aprimoradas fornecidas pelo formato ESP. |
IRTC | Use para capturar tráfego de rede em tempo real e para disparar eventos quando eles ocorrem. Essa interface é usada por aplicativos NPP que exigem capturas em tempo de execução. Observe que essa interface não fornece as estatísticas que as outras interfaces NPP fornecem, nem permite inserir quadros no tráfego de rede capturado. |
IStats | Use para recuperar estatísticas de captura, mas não os quadros capturados. |